Did You Know...
On April 16, 2010 the Hill Country Family Services (HCFS) held the annual Food Fair. Thanks to dedicated volunteers HCFS was able to distribute approximately 37,000 lbs of food to over 151 needy families. |

25 Years in the Making! You are cordially invited to attend the 25th Anniversary Celebration of Hill Country Family Services dedication to Kendall County's most vulnerable families. The Annual Style Show and Luncheon will be held on Wednesday, 10/27/10 at the Boerne Community and Convention Center. Activities will begin at 10am with a silent auction and reception followed by a luncheon, style show and live auction at noon. Tickets are $30.00 each.
